Rachel was born in Glasgow and graduated from RSAMD (now Royal Conservatoire Scotland). She went on to star as long running lead 'Tiffany Bowles' in STV’s ever popular HIGH ROAD. In Scotland earlier theatre roles included Desdemona in TAG’s OTHELLO, Estella in the Traverse’s GREAT EXPECTATIONS, Lady Capulet in Stray’s ROMEO AND JULIET and Lady Macbeth in MACBETH at the Byre and Elmire in TARTUFFE.

Rachel recently appeared in the dark political drama SEX OFFENCE at the Edinburgh Festival and as 'Petra' in the acclaimed financial drama F*CKED.COM at the Traverse Theatre. Other theatre work includes Huckleberry Finn in TOM SAWYER at Contact Theatre Manchester, Laura in Pocket Theatre’s THE GLASS MENAGERIE, Margaret Hymen in York Theatre Royal’s BROKEN GLASS, Paines Plough’s groundbreaking production of YOU CANNOT GO FORWARD at Oran Mor/Traverse and Manchester Royal Exchange; Irene Pollock in THE WORLD ACCORDING TO BERTIE by Alexander McCall Smith and Doris Day in BIOGRAPHIES IN A BAG by Lynn Ferguson both at the Edinburgh Festival where Rachel also wrote, presented and performed her critically acclaimed one-woman show THE CROSSING (Gilded Balloon) that went on to tour the UK and LA.

Rachel has played a diversity of tv roles from EASTENDERS, SILENT WITNESS, RIVER CITY AND TAGGERT to 'Angela' in the award winning DEAD SET (Channel 4), Radio work includes: ‘After Icarus’ (BBC Radio Scotland), Mrs Pinkerton in ‘Pinkerton’ (BBC Radio 4), Amber in ‘The Fly’ and Death in ‘Splitting the Atom’ both for Weird Tales (BBC Radio 4).

Rachel is also an established voiceover artist.
